Red Dead Redemption 2 is an incredibly dense open-world game that`s jam-packed full of details. In our time spent playing the high-anticipated sequel recently, we discovered a wealth of mechanics that go above and beyond those from the original Red Dead Redemption. While the game features improvements to pre-existing mechanics, there are light survival systems this time around that have you paying attention to body temperature, gun maintenance, and meat expiration.
